What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970:  The
employer did not
fur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from
recognized hazards that
were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to
employees in that employees
were exposed to the following:
a.At the site where framing work was being accomplished, a worker was
exposed to a fall
hazard when he was being lowered while standing on the fork of a Skytrak
Legacy 8042,
SN# 610029, rough terrain forklift from the roof deck to the ground.
Among the feasible means of abatement that can be used to correct this are:
Utilize only platforms designed for elevating personnel with forklifts.
Platforms must
meet the requirement set forth in ANSI/ASME B56.6-2002.
